Firewall Cisco consists of five major types, which are discussed below
Packet layer: It analyzes traffic in the transportation protocol layer. Applications can communicate using specific protocols: UDP (User Datagram Protocol) and TCP (Transmission Control Protocol). This type of firewall inspects the data packs at this layer, watching for malicious code that can contaminate your device or network. It gets rid of a pack if it is identified as a possible threat.
Application layer: Ensures that only adequate information exists at the application level before letting it pass through.
Circuit level: A circuit-level Cisco firewall is positioned as a layer among the application layer of the Internet protocol stack and transport layer.
Software firewalls: Common types of software firewall can be found on PCs. It functions by examining data packs that flow to & from the device. The info in the packages is compared against a list of risk signatures. If a pack matches the profile of a recognized threat, it is rejected.
Proxy server: It examines the captured information coming out of or going into a network. It acts as a separate system between the internet and your device. Also, this type has its own IP address.

It is a network security tech device that filters and monitors outgoing and incoming network traffic based on a company’s formerly established security strategies. In other words, a firewall is basically the barrier that sits between the public internet and the private internal network.
